Tue 18th November 2025
Northern Premier League
Hebburn Town 5 Ilkeston Town 0
Acting manager Craig Swinscoe apologised to the fans who made the long journey after Ilkeston took a hammering at Hebburn. It was a woeful performance in the pouring rain which started badly and got worse. Hebburn took just 3 minutes to take the lead and after 29 minutes Ilkeston were reduced to ten players when Seth Okyere saw red after committing a last man offence.
Hebburn made light work of the conditions while Ilkeston floundered and Liam Murray opened the scoring after leaving defenders in his wake and firing past Alfie Roberts. Cameron Darcy was next to have a go but his effort was too high. The same player then forced Roberts to save his low effort. With Ilkeston struggling to get a foothold they suffered an injury blow when Sam Parker had go off and this was quickly followed by a second Hebburn goal and a red card for Okyere. Gary Martin slammed home the resultant penalty to double Hebburn’s lead. The rain got heavier and after 35 minutes it was 3-0 when Micky Turner was left unmarked in the area and allowed to head home a Rob Briggs cross. With a player short Ilkeston couldn’t muster a reply so trailed by three at half time.
Ilkeston started the second half looking more secure but it didn’t last and Hebburn were awarded another penalty on 58 minutes for a handball which Martin converted again. As Hebburn relaxed Ilkeston were able to push forward and a Dylan Youmbi effort flew over the bar, Another Youmbi attempt was only just wide. Just when Ilkeston were enjoying some late ascendency Hebburn struck again. Roberts did well to parry a close range effort but Martin was there to force the ball over the line to complete a hat-trick.

I think that it’s time to face up to the fact that we have a disciplinary problem. Seven red cards by November and countless yellows is clearly not acceptable. I know yellows are easily come by and we want our players to be combative but it seems that we need to be educating the players in how to avoid receiving cards.
Last night surely it would have been better if Seth Okyere had allowed their player a chance to score rather than concede a penalty and lose him for the remainder of the match and then for a period of suspension.
I know it’s easy to say in retrospect. Cards are shown for so many minor offences now and players need to be so careful to avoid them unnecessarily.
